
(AP) — Icy winter weather has left most of the 150,000 residents of Mississippi’s capital with little or no running water for days.
Freezing temperatures have knocked out power and water to parts of the Deep South.
The icy conditions are part of a viciously cold spell that has also devastated Texas. In Jackson, Mississippi, many people had gone since Monday without running water since Monday.
Water bottles were being delivered to people’s apartment complexes or brought to central locations for people to pick up.
In Louisiana about 1 million people were under a boil water advisory while another 245,000 people were grappling with water outages.
